Research Grants Management Unit
The Research Grants Management Unit (RGMU) plays a pivotal role in supporting the Cape Peninsula University of Technology (CPUT) research community by facilitating access to both internal and external funding opportunities. The unit is dedicated to empowering researchers, particularly early career, emerging, and established researchers through targeted financial support that advances research excellence and capacity development across the university.
RGMU provides internal funding to support a wide range of research activities, including:
- Participation in academic conferences.
- Development of collaborative research initiatives.
- Procurement of research materials and supplies.
- Completion of postgraduate qualifications (Master’s and Doctoral degrees) for CPUT staff members.
In addition to internal support, RGMU actively promotes and assists researchers in identifying and applying for prestigious national and international funding opportunities. These include, but are not limited to, grants offered by:
- National Research Foundation (NRF)
- Department of Higher Education and Training (DHET)
- Department of Science and Innovation (DSI)
- South African Medical Research Council (SAMRC)
- Wellcome Trust and other global funding bodies
By aligning funding opportunities with the strategic research priorities of the university, RGMU ensures that researchers are well-positioned to contribute meaningfully to scientific innovation, socio-economic development, and global research impact.
